作品概览

  • Artistic style: Postmodern
  • Title: Lability
  • Notable elements or techniques:
    • Assemblage
    • Kinetic element
  • Subject or theme: Uncertainty of man in a postmodern world
  • Dimensions: 150 x 80 cm
  • Year: 1974

The Ephemeral Balance: Exploring Lubo Kristek's Lability

To stand before Lubo Kristek’s Lability is not merely to observe an object; it is to engage in a delicate, almost precarious dialogue with entropy itself. This striking assemblage, dating from 1974, captures the very essence of modern existence—a state of perpetual, beautiful instability. The piece centers around a wooden structure crowned by a metal ball fashioned into a face, immediately drawing the viewer into its mechanical poetry. Kristek masterfully constructs an environment where balance is not a fixed state but a momentary triumph over gravity. It invites participation, compelling the observer to test the limits of equilibrium, mirroring the constant negotiation we undertake with the unpredictable currents of contemporary life.

Symbolism of Uncertainty and the Self

The title itself, Lability, speaks volumes about the artist’s preoccupation with flux. The artwork functions as a sophisticated toy—a tumbler whose inherent design dictates that any deviation from its center will inevitably lead to a return, suggesting a cyclical nature to human experience. Yet, this return is never guaranteed; it is always earned through effort. Kristek layers profound philosophical weight onto this seemingly playful mechanism. He speaks of the "architectonic of the soul," hinting at an inner structure—a labyrinth hidden within the wood itself—that requires specialized tools and deep excavation to even perceive. This suggests that the self, much like the sculpture, is a complex system, beautiful in its potential but constantly under the pressure of external forces.

Materiality and the Echoes of Time

What elevates Lability beyond mere assemblage is Kristek’s profound reverence for used objects. He possesses an almost archaeological sensibility, seeking out components that have already lived lives. For him, the history embedded within these disparate materials—the frequency of their previous states—is as vital to the artwork as the artist's hand. The face itself, rendered from a collage of wood, metal, and perhaps stone, embodies this principle; it is an accumulation of histories. Furthermore, the inclusion of surrounding elements in the photograph—the watchful horses, the ticking clocks, the silent chairs—suggests that Lability exists within a larger narrative space, where time itself is both measured and fluid.

A Touch of the Mime and the Modern Condition

The face’s specific depiction, resembling the mime artist Ladislav Fialka, adds a layer of poignant commentary. The mime, by profession, masters the art of conveying emotion through constraint and illusion. Here, Kristek seems to place this artistic archetype within the context of the "whipping boy"—a figure perpetually at the mercy of others' narratives. This juxtaposition forces us to question agency: are we the performers in our own lives, or merely objects manipulated by unseen hands? 艺术家简介

沉浸式体验的先驱:Lubo Kristek 的生命与艺术

1943年出生于捷克布尔诺的 Lubo Kristek,作为战后欧洲艺术界中一个举足轻新的声音脱颖而出,其作品难以被简单的标签所定义。他的艺术旅程始于动荡的20世纪60年代,那是一个充满实验精神并不断质疑既定规范的时代。从创作之初,Kristek 就展现出一种不安分的灵魂,拒绝被传统的媒介或手法所束缚。他并不满足于仅仅创造物质对象,而是试图编排一场场体验,模糊艺术、生活与观众参与之间的界限。这种挑战传统的早期倾向,成为了他丰硕艺术生涯的定义性特征。当时捷克斯洛伐克的政治气候无疑激发了他对艺术自由的渴望,推动他在概念上大胆探索,并在潜移默化中进行着某种颠覆性的尝试。

从组合艺术到“全息感知”

Kristek 的作品根植于组合艺术(Assemblage)——这是一种利用各种散落的拾得物创作三维艺术品的技法。然而,他很快便超越了这种技法的纯形式层面,为他的组合作品注入了深层的意义与社会评论。他的雕塑并非仅仅是材料的堆砌,而是对人类脆弱性、医学伦理以及我们与自然界复杂关系的批判性审视。1968年“布拉格之春”后,Kristek 移居西德,这成为了他艺术发展中的关键转折点。这次迁徙让他接触到了全新的思想与影响,巩固了他对概念艺术、超现实主义和行为艺术的追求。正是在这一时期,他开始构思其开创性的“全息感知”理论。Kristek 认为,真正的艺术冲击力并非通过单一、线性的体验来实现,而是通过多种感官与情感的同步激发。他将艺术品构想为多维的环境,旨在为观众创造一种整体性的、沉浸式的体验——正如全息图在其结构中包含了所有的视角一般。

偶发艺术、夜间开幕式与公共介入

Kristek “全息感知”理论的实践应用,在他那些极具震撼力的偶发艺术(Happenings)夜间开幕式(Nocturnal Vernissages)中得到了最强有力的体现。这些并非传统的艺术展览开幕,而是经过精心编排的事件,旨在打破观众的预期,并在直觉层面引发共鸣。这些集会通常在深夜举行,模糊了艺术家、艺术品与旁观者之间的界限。Kristek 的介入行为甚至延伸到了画廊围墙之外,频繁地溢出到公共空间中。例如位于布尔诺的《Kristek House》——一座被转化为超现实建筑组合体的建筑——展示了他致力于让艺术走向大众并挑战既定城市景观观念的决心。另一个引人注目的例子是行为作品《与神经质狐狸的散步》,它直面关于死亡与生命终结的社会禁忌,邀请观众去面对那些令人不安的真相。而他的作品《移动电话安魂曲》则对我们日益增长的技术依赖进行了深刻的批判,引发人们对持续连接所带来的情感代价的反思。

传承与深远影响

Lubo Kristek 对当代艺术的贡献是深邃且影响广泛的。他不仅仅是在创作艺术品,更是在开创一种关于艺术体验的新思维方式。他对沉浸感、参与感以及多媒介整合的强调,已经影响了行为艺术、装置艺术和概念雕塑领域的几代艺术家。尽管他的作品经常触及复杂的社会与伦理议题,但其表达从未显得说教或刻板。相反,Kristek 邀请观众以自己的方式去理解这些主题,从而培养批判性思维并激发情感共鸣。他的遗产不仅保存在收藏其作品的众多博物馆与馆藏中——包括德国的 Museum Kunstsalon Franke Schenk 和捷克的布拉格大教堂——更通过全球艺术家与学者对其思想的持续探索而得以延续。无论是通过复制品还是亲身实践,去发现 Kristek 的作品都是一次走出常规边界、拥抱艺术力量那更为完整且沉浸式理解的邀请。他的愿景将继续激励着那些试图创造能与人类精神产生真正共鸣之体验的人们。

艺术家简介

  • Artistic Movement Or Style:
    • 概念艺术
    • 超现实主义
    • 行为艺术
  • Date Of Birth: 1943年5月8日
  • Full Name: Lubo Kristek
  • Nationality: 捷克
  • Notable Artworks:
    • Kristek House
    • 圣安东尼的诱惑
    • 在过早克隆的时代……
  • Place Of Birth: 捷克,布尔诺
